However, to learn, you need to develop a general troubleshooting approach - a logical, methodical, method of narrowing down the problem. A tech tip database might suggest: 'Replace C536' for a particular symptom. This is good advice for a specific problem on one model. However, what you really want to understand is why C536 was the cause and how to pinpoint the culprit in general even if you don't have a service manual or schematic and your tech tip database doesn't have an entry for your sick TV or VCR.

While schematics are nice, you won't always have them or be able to justify the purchase for a one-of repair. Therefore, in many cases, some reverse engineering will be necessary. The time will be well spent since even if you don't see another instance of the same model in your entire lifetime, you will have learned something in the process that can be applied to other equipment problems.
As always, when you get stuck, checking out a tech-tips database may quickly identify your problem and solution.In that case, you can greatly simplify your troubleshooting or at least confirm a diagnosis before ordering parts.

REPAIR / SERVICING TV LG 47LE5300

Technical description and composition of the LG 47LE5300 TV, panel type and applicable modules. The composition of the modules.
LG
Model: 47LE5300
Chassis / Version: LD01D
Panel: LC470EUH (SC) (A1)
Lamp backlight: 3660L-0348A, 3660L-0349A
Inverter (backlight): integrated into PSU
PWM Inverter: YP4247LPB
Power Supply (PSU): EAY60803401 YP47LPBL
PWM Power: PFC, PWM
MOSFET Power: N-FET TO-220F
MainBoard: EAX61766102 (0) EBT60927321
IC MainBoard: CPU: LGE101DB-LF-T8, SDRAM: K4B1G1646E-HCH9, Flash: W25Q80, EEPROM: 24C1024
Tuner: TDTJ-S001D

General recommendations for repairing TV LCD
Possible malfunctions
- The LG 47LE5300 TV does not turn on and does not show any signs of being turned on, does not respond to the control buttons or to the remote control.
Usually with such manifestations, the defect is caused by faulty elements in the main power supply module EAY60803401. It is necessary to measure its output voltages and, if they are absent, to check for short-circuit probabilities in the converters, power switches and rectifier diodes.
In case of diode breakdowns in the secondary circuits, the converter can operate in emergency short-circuit mode without output voltages, and during short circuit in the power elements of the primary circuit, the mains fuse and / or current sensor at the source of the key usually breaks.
The breakdown of Mos-Fet keys used in pulsed sources is often caused by malfunctions of other elements, for example, in the power supply circuit of a PWM controller, in frequency-setting or damping circuits, as well as in Negative Stabilization Feedback. PWM microcircuits are usually checked by replacement with new ones, or obviously working.
- There is no image, there is sound, all other functions of the TV work. When turned on, the image may sometimes appear for a second.
These manifestations can be triggered by a power module, or by defects in the inverter, as well as a distortion of the currents in the lamps due to their uneven wear. If all the electrolytic capacitors of the filter according to the inverter power supply are serviceable, you should make sure that the lamps are working, then you need to check the converter keys and the secondary windings of the transformers.
Sometimes, for diagnostic purposes, it is necessary to disable the inverter protection. In such cases, special care must be taken during work, and the protection circuit should be restored immediately after the repair is completed.
- The indicator blinks or lights constantly, the TV does not turn on, does not respond to the remote control.
Repair or diagnostics of the EAX61766102 motherboard should begin by checking the stabilizers and power converters needed to power the chips and matrix. If necessary, update or replace the software (software). In cases of complex repairs of MB (SSB) and in the presence of the necessary skills and equipment, sometimes it may be necessary to replace its CPU chips: LGE101DB-LF-T8, SDRAM: K4B1G1646E-HCH9, Flash: W25Q80, EEPROM: 24C1024 and other possible faulty components. Malfunctions associated with the application of BGA soldering technologies are usually easily diagnosed by the heating method.
The TDTJ-S001D tuner malfunction is established after checking the software and all supply voltages at its terminals. The data exchange of the tuner with the processor via the I2C bus can be controlled by an oscilloscope.

Main features of the device LG 47LE5300:
Installed matrix (LCD panel) LC470EUH (SC) (A1).
To power the backlight, a converter is used, combined with the power supply, controlled by the YP4247LPB PWM controller.
The necessary supply voltages for all nodes of the LG 47LE5300 TV are generated by the EAY60803401 power module or its analogs using PFC, PWM microcircuits and power switches of the N-FET TO-220F type.
MainBoard - the main board (motherboard) is an EAX61766102 module using CPU chips: LGE101DB-LF-T8, SDRAM: K4B1G1646E-HCH9, Flash: W25Q80, EEPROM: 24C1024 and others.
The TDTJ-S001D tuner provides TV reception and channel tuning.
Additional technical information about the panel:
Brand: LG Display
Model: LC470EUH-SCA1
Type: a-Si TFT-LCD, Panel
Diagonal size: 47 inch
Resolution: 1920x1080, FHD
Display Mode: S-IPS, Normally Black, Transmissive
Active Area: 1039.68x584.82 mm
Surface: Antiglare (Haze 10%), Hard coating (3H)
Brightness: 450 cd / m²
Contrast Ratio: 1400: 1
Display Colors: 1.07B (8-bit + Dithering), CIE1931 72%
Response Time: 8/10 (Tr / Td)
Frequency: 120Hz
Lamp Type: WLED Without Driver
Signal Interface: Mini LVDS, 120 pins
Voltage: 12.0V
